About the role
Our Opportunity
Work Location: Cloudbreak - Fortescue’s Cloudbreak mine is located on the traditional lands of the Palyku and Nyiyaparli peoples
Roster: 8D/6R – FIFO ex Perth
Fortescue are currently seeking an experienced Reliability Engineer to join our team at Cloudbreak on a family friendly 8/6 roster. This role is responsible for providing reliability engineering support, data analysis, improvement projects, safety projects and defect elimination for the operational Ore Processing Facility (OPF), to enable sustained asset performance within the cost objectives.The Reliability Engineer is responsible for enhancing the reliability and performance of plant equipment through data analysis, technical expertise, and project management. This role involves developing maintenance strategies, supporting operational teams, and leading reliability projects in line with asset management standards.
Key Responsibilities
Review reliability strategies as well as the implementation of the strategies, to drive continual improvement of plant reliability and uptime.Analyse failures and implement changes to minimise the risk of reoccurrence.Running of the Defect Elimination process including cooperating with other departments and suppliers.Shutdown support to solve implementation issues.Identify cost saving initiative for OPEX reduction.
Qualifications And Experience
Bachelor’s degree in Mechanical Engineering.Minimum 5 years experience as a Mechanical EngineerExtensive experience in reliability engineering and asset management principles, particularly in the resource industry.Strong knowledge of asset management principles, reliability metrics and maintenance strategy management.Proven track record in managing technical projects.Working understanding of Condition Monitoring & Lubrication techniquesA high level of planning, problem solving, organisational, scheduling and co-ordination skills.Knowledge of EAM, CMMS software including knowledge of SAP operation.Strong ability on computer-based programs such as MS office suite and Navisworks.Strong communication skills and stakeholder management skills.
